    I've been thinking about this for a while. Water isn't really possible to measure in the short term.
    I guess you just have to average over time. But body fat CAN be measured, or at least you can
    measure differences. There are three ways to do it (domestically) skinfold calipers electrical
    impedance (omron/tanita) mirror It's probably best to use all three to be anywhere near accurate. It
    also needs to be done over time. The electrical impedance is supposed to be very inaccurate but
    again graphed over time it should be OK. Skinfold calipers are the best (domestically) but they are
    very difficult to use properly as I'm finding out.

    Reverting to old eating patterns is a real problem for me too. Apparently most people don't lose
    much weight, and very few keep it off for any length of time. So reverting isn't failure - it's the
    norm! Thats not to say that it's acceptable. I guess we all have to try to find a way to keep up the
    good eating, but I can see it's not easy. I'm depending on you and Lesanne and some others for
    inspiration 🙂
